Today was the final episode of Kim Matula, who for over four years has been front and center on the The Bold and the Beautiful as the younger heroine of the show, Hope Logan Spencer.

B&B did an exceptional job in production of incorporating the elements  of slow motion camera looks, music, edits, montages, story and performance to wrap-up in short order Matula’s exit story throughout the entire week. SPOILER ALERT: If you have not watched today’s episode do not read any further.

In story, after losing her and Wyatt’s (Darin Brooks) unborn baby due to a terrible tumble down the stairs at the Forrester mansion, Hope comes back to the scene of the incident which occurred after a fight with her mother-in-law Quinn (Rena Sofer).  Liam (Scott Clifton), who has been there every step of the way for Hope, finds his star-crossed love, and the two have a simple, yet meaningful talk.  Hope tells Liam, she will always love him, but that she is going away to Milan to see her mother Brooke (Katherine Kelly Lang).  She needs time to heal from all she has been through.  And as to when she is coming back, Liam comes to understand he may not see her again for quite some time.

Elsewhere, Wyatt is devastated and guilt-ridden that he not only lost his unborn son, but probably his wife Hope as well, and really lays into his mother for her over-protectiveness, something he then says he should have done for Hope!  Quinn even goes so far as to consider jumping from the Quinn Artisan warehouse rooftop and committing suicide as Bill (Don Diamont) happens upon the scene encouraging her to do so!

In the end, with one last montage, several glances, and plenty emotion, Hope and Liam share one last moment as Hope walks away … and in a symbolic moment … vanishes.

Kudos throughout the week have to go to the performances of Kim Matula, Scott Clifton and Darin Brooks who all stepped up to the plate and played the beats of this long-enduring triangle.

It was just over 13 years ago on General Hospital when Ava Jerome (Maura West) shot and killed Kate Howard/Connie Falconeri (Kelly Sullivan) in an effort to keep her quiet from revealing that Derek Wells was actually Ava’s back-from-the-dead brother, Julian Jerome (William deVry). It’s a crime that somehow Ava never has quite paid for either.

The episode back aired on August 13, 2013 and viewers had to say goodbye to Kelly Sullivan who played Kate and her alter, Connie. In the story, just before she died, Kate/Connie scrawled the letters AJ in her own blood, initially making the PCPD and Sonny Corinthos (Maurice Benard) think that it was AJ Quatermaine (Sean Kanan) who did the deed.

Now, Sullivan recalled sharing scenes with the three-time Daytime Emmy-winning West, during a live conversation on You Tube’s Michael Fairman Channel. Kelly was the special guest talking about her recent return to the soaps in her new role as The Bold and the Beautiful’s Darcy Dylan.

Photo: JPI

FIRST IMPRESSIONS OF MAURA WEST

Speaking of her final GH scenes and working with Maura West, Sullivan gave her then GH co-star major props. “If you’re going to be shot by somebody (on the soaps), you want to be shot by Maura West, c’mon!”

Maura West debuted back in May 2013 as Ava, and Sullivan remembered when the As the World Turns favorite began on GH. “I remember when Maura West first arrived at GH. She walked in with this cute little bob (hairdo) and she’s just delicious,” shared Sullivan.

A STREETCAR NAMED DESIRE

Kelly revealed more about Maura, adding “I think she’s amazing! I remember right before I left the show, someone suggested, and I would still love to do this with her, if she ever want to, but someone suggested that they wanted to direct the stage play A Streetcar Named Desire with Maura and I, where I would play Stella and she would play Blanche! Wouldn’t that be great?”

Speaking of the Ava/Connie showdown scenes, Sullivan expressed, “On television and on General Hospital specifically, Maura West is able to play a character who does the most horrendous things and you still care about her and that’s the mark of a really great actor. In other words, you’re able to be liked in the midst of the most horrendous things, and as a performer not shying away from that, and to just have the courage to do what’s on the page (in the script).”

Photo: JPI

KELLY SULLIVAN PARTING THOUGHTS AS SHE LEFT GENERAL HOSPITAL

Kelly also shared her sentiments when she walked off the set of General Hospital after her run back in August of 2013. “I really was honored. Every day I would go to work and I would say a little prayer, which is I want to do justice for my character, explained Kelly. “It’s between me and my character. I get to walk this path with her and to leave the show on that note, which is, I left every out there. I just gave it my all and again what an honor it was to play Kate/Connie.”

The question of will Steve Burton (Jason Morgan) stay awhile at General Hospital after his recent extended hiatus from the show earlier this year, has reportedly been answered.

TMZ via court documents obtained in Burton’s ongoing legal battle with his ex-wife Sheree Gustin, shared that Steve actually inked a new three year deal with the ABC soap opera back in June.

That is significant because it was June when Burton returned back to work as Jason. In addition, the court filing confirmed that Burton had already moved back to California from Tennessee.

Steve Burton

Photo: ABC

STEVE’S HIATUS AND HIS RETURN TO PORT CHARLES

GH fans will recall, it was back in February of 2026, that Burton announced via his Instagram that he was stepping away from his role of Jason Morgan for short break and pointed to wanting to spend quality time with his new wife, Michelle Lundstrom Burton with whom he tied the knot back on May 17, 2025.

Steve expressed at that time, “I’m newly married and looking forward to spending some quality time with my family.” It was back on March 25 that viewers saw Jason carted away by the WSB after taking the fall for Rocco Falconeri (Finn Carr) who shot then WSB Director Ross Cullum (Andrew Hawkes).

Burton returned to work on June 1, and due to General Hospital taping roughly six weeks ahead of air, made his on-screen comeback on the July 13 episode.

GOING FOR GOLD AT THE UPCOMING DAYTIME EMMYS

Then, Steve and his enduring fans got an extra special treat on the same day, when it was revealed on Extra that he was nominated for the upcoming 53rd annual Daytime Emmy Awards in the Outstanding Lead Actor in a Daytime Drama Series category.

Steve previously won in the Supporting Actor category for his work as General Hospital’s Jason in 1998 and as The Young and the Restless’ Dylan McAvoy in 2018.

Now with Jason and Britt’s (Kelly Thiebaud) relationship seemingly hitting the skids, plus Jason’s commitment to staying out of mob life to focus on being present for his son Danny Morgan (Asher Antonyzyn), what does the future hold for the fan favorite character? Stay tuned.

The Young and the Restless enduring favorite and two-time Daytime Emmy-winning actress, Jess Walton (Jill Foster Abbott) is set to release her memoir!

Kensington Publishing has revealed on their website that Walton’s book The Young and the Rest of Us is now available for pre-order while listing an April 27, 2027 release date. In addition, in June of 2027, Walton will mark her 40th anniversary with The Young and the Restless and her debut as Jill.

The official log lines for the memoir share, “Emmy Award-winning actress Jess Walton, known to millions as the iconic Jill Abbott on the #1 soap opera The Young and the Restless, shares her extraordinary journey to stardom, sobriety, true love, and self-discovery in this startingly candid, intimate, and star-studded memoir.”

Jess Walton

Photo; Kensington Books

CAKE FIGHTS AND CORPORATE INTRIGUE

The book description for The Young and the Rest of Us adds,  “In June 1987, Jess Walton walked through the artists’ entrance at CBS for her first day on The Young and the Restless,where she had just been hired to play the recast role of Jill AbbottTwo Emmy awards, four decades, and countless onscreen affairs, marriages, corporate takeovers, and cake fights later, she’s a beloved icon with an astonishing tale to tell.”

“In her refreshingly candid style, Jess shares her journey as a young actress from Toronto theaters to Los Angeles, where she found herself at the center of a Laurel Canyon circle that included the likes of Neil Young, David Geffen, Laura Nyro, and Joni Mitchell. Landing a Universal contract and a steady stream of guest starring roles, Jess embraced everything 1970s L.A. had to offer—including Hollywood parties fueled by limitless booze and drugs, and trysts with stars. She recounts with candor and gratitude the surprising path that eventually led her to sobriety, true love—and ultimately, to fictional Genoa City, Wisconsin, and the role of a lifetime.”

“Brimming with behind-the-scenes drama and celebrity cameos to delight fans, The Young and the Rest of Us is also rich in personal, relatable truths about marriage, motherhood, empty-nesting, self-discovery, and finding the courage to start over—as often as it takes. In a voice as fearless and frank as Jill’s, but with, humor and grace all her own, Jess Walton looks back on a life as unpredictable, and adventure filled as anything she has portrayed on screen.”

WHO ELSE PLAYED JILL FOSER ABBOTT?

Fans of The Young and the Restless know that Walton became the fourth actress to take on the role of Katherine Chancellor’s original nemesis Jill Foster back in 1987. The OG Jill was played by Brenda Dickson, also Deborah Adair, Bond Gideon and Melinda O. Fee played the part.

This year, Days of our Lives star Lauren Koslow (Kate Roberts) filled-in for several episodes for Walton who was unavailable to travel from her home in Oregon to Los Angeles where Y&R was taped. Walton is still with the long-running soap opera as Jill.
